Bremen Storm Flood Realities
Water damage in Bremen tends to cluster in predictable windows because of the local climate. Bremen, Georgia is prone to flooding due to its location in a rural area with low-lying terrain and frequent heavy rainfall. The surrounding agricultural land and lack of extensive drainage systems contribute to water accumulation during storms.
The region experiences a humid subtropical climate with high precipitation levels, especially during the late spring and early summer months. This leads to increased flood risks, particularly in low-lying areas and near waterways.
